Liquid densities and excess molar volumes for binary systems (ionic liquids plus methanol or water) at 298.15, 303.15 and 313.15 K, and at atmospheric pressure

Binary excess molar volumes, V-m(E), have been evaluated from density measurements, using a vibrating tube densimeter over the entire composition range for binary liquid mixtures of ionic liquids 1-ethyl-3-methyl-imidazolium diethyleneglycol monomethylethersulphate [EMIM](+)[CH3(OCH2)(2)OSO3](-) or 1-butyl-3-methyl-imidazolium diethyleneglycol monomethylethersulphate [BMIM](+)[CH3(OCH2CH2)(2)OSO3](-) or 1-methyl-3-octyl-imidazolium diethyleneglycol monomethylethersulphate [MOIM](+)[CH3(OCH2CH2)(2)OSO3](-) + methanol and [EMIM](+)[CH3(OCH2CH2)(2)OSO3](-) water at 298.15, 303.15 and 313.15 K. The V-m(E) values were found to be negative for all systems studied. The V-m(E) results are explained in terms of intermolecular interactions and packing effects. The experimental data were fitted by the Redlich-Kister polynomial.
